Understanding the Emerald Cut Diamond
The emerald cut is a step-cut diamond, meaning its facets are rectangular rather than triangular, arranged in a ‘step-like’ pattern. Unlike brilliant cuts designed to maximize fire and sparkle, the emerald cut emphasizes clarity and produces a sophisticated, geometric brilliance with a distinctive ‘hall-of-mirrors’ effect. This arises from the interplay of light within its broad, open facets. Its large surface area and elongated shape can make inclusions more visible, thus placing a higher emphasis on clarity when buying an emerald cut diamond.
Originating from ancient Egypt and popularized in the Art Deco era, the emerald cut exudes timeless elegance and is often favored for its vintage charm. Its rectangular shape can also create an illusion of a larger size compared to other cuts of the same carat weight. The 4 Cs and Emerald Cut Diamonds
When buying an emerald cut diamond, the universally recognized 4 Cs—Cut, Clarity, Color, and Carat Weight—take on specific importance due to the nature of this unique cut. Understanding how each ‘C’ influences the diamond’s appearance and value is essential for making an informed purchase in Concord, NH.
Cut: While the ‘cut’ grade for step cuts like the emerald focuses on symmetry, polish, and the arrangement of facets rather than brilliance potential (as in brilliant cuts), a well-executed cut is paramount. It dictates the diamond’s ‘hall-of-mirrors’ effect and overall visual appeal. Look for excellent symmetry and polish.
Clarity: Due to the large, open facets of the emerald cut, inclusions are more easily visible. Therefore, clarity is often prioritized. While flawless (FL) or internally flawless (IF) diamonds are rare and expensive, aiming for a clarity grade of Very Slightly Included (VS1, VS2) or even Slightly Included (SI1) can offer excellent value, provided the inclusions are not conspicuous to the naked eye. Color: Emerald cuts tend to show color more readily than brilliant cuts. While colorless diamonds (D-F grades) are the most valuable, Near Colorless grades (G-J) can appear beautifully white, especially when expertly cut and set. Prioritize Clarity: Given the emerald cut’s nature, focus on clarity grades where inclusions are minimal or undetectable to the naked eye. VS and SI grades are often excellent value propositions. A reputable jeweler can point out inclusions and help you choose a stone where they are well-hidden.
Consider Color: Aim for a color grade within the G-J range for a diamond that appears white and brilliant. The setting of the diamond can also influence the perception of color; platinum or white gold settings are ideal for maximizing whiteness, while yellow gold can complement slightly warmer (lower) color grades.
Aspect Ratio: Emerald cuts come in various proportions. Standard ratios are around 1.4:1 to 1.5:1 (length-to-width). More elongated cuts (e.g., 1.6:1 or higher) can appear larger and slimmer on the finger, while squarer cuts (closer to 1:1) offer a different aesthetic. Your personal preference and intended setting will guide this choice.

The Value Proposition of Emerald Cut Diamonds
Buying an emerald cut diamond offers a unique value proposition compared to other diamond shapes. While brilliant cuts are designed for maximum sparkle, the emerald cut provides a different kind of beauty—a sophisticated, architectural elegance that appeals to those seeking a distinctive style. This distinctive character comes with potential cost advantages.
Because emerald cuts don’t maximize light return in the same way brilliant cuts do, they often command lower prices per carat, especially when comparing diamonds of similar clarity and color grades. This means you might be able to afford a larger carat weight or a higher clarity grade within the same budget compared to purchasing a round brilliant diamond. The price of an emerald cut diamond is determined by its carat weight, clarity, color, and cut quality. Generally, emerald cuts are more affordable per carat than round brilliant diamonds, especially if you are willing to consider diamonds in the G-J color range and VS or SI clarity grades, where inclusions are often eye-clean. For example, a 1-carat emerald cut diamond might be priced significantly lower than a 1-carat round brilliant of comparable quality, allowing you to potentially purchase a larger stone or prioritize clarity and color within your budget.
Factors Influencing Price
- Carat Weight: Larger diamonds command higher prices, with costs increasing exponentially beyond certain weight thresholds (e.g., 1 carat, 2 carats).
- Clarity: Flawless diamonds are the most expensive. VS and SI grades offer excellent value for eye-clean stones.
- Color: Colorless diamonds (D-F) are premium-priced. Near-colorless (G-J) diamonds offer great beauty at a more accessible price point.
- Cut Quality: While emerald cuts are graded differently, excellent symmetry and polish contribute to a higher value.
- Market Demand: Trends in diamond popularity and overall economic conditions can influence pricing.

One of the most frequent errors is neglecting the importance of clarity. Because emerald cuts display their internal characteristics openly, choosing a diamond with inclusions that are too noticeable can detract from its beauty. Always inquire about the clarity grade and, if possible, view the diamond under magnification or request detailed photos/videos. Another mistake is focusing solely on carat weight without considering the other Cs. A large diamond with poor color or clarity may not be as visually appealing as a smaller, higher-quality stone.
